抄録

Dredging work in marine construction causes some damage to fisheries industry and ecosystem due to turbidity. In the worst case, turbidity may cause suspension of construction work, and it affects the construction schedule. This study examines the development of filtration methodology to remove suspended solid by using a spring filter, which has been developed so far. Experiments and simulation was performed in water aqueous suspension, and development of a device for reducing the environmental impact was investigated. From many of the combination of experiment and simulation, we got the knowledge about the filtration accuracy and processing flow rate of filter aid.
